Timing belt conveyors are intended exclusively for moving products in pieces. Timng belt conveyors are based on a frame taken from the “item” system.
These conveyors are the alternative to belt conveyors - they extend the application area of Haberkorn - Ulmer conveyors.
Technical design of the standard timing belt conveyor:
The basic frame of the conveyor is made of aluminium grooved profiles of the “item” modular system
Depending on the nature of the material being conveyed, more than two timing belt conveyor branches can be selected
The belt is moved by the aluminium driving and driven sprocket wheel
Aluminium turnbuckles for the driven and driving sprocket with swivelling ball bearings for tensioning the transport belt
Plastic slide-way under the timing belt, with a flat or folded outer edge (side guidance)
Polyurethane timing belt, abrasion and oil resistant
The drive comprises a compact unit composed of a three-phase asynchronous electric drive and a worm-gear system, or the drive is completed with an inserted transmission gear with an indented belt.
The speed is either constant or can be controlled by means of a frequency converter. At the conveyor with an inserted gearing mechanism, it is possible to change the constant speed by replacing the transmission gear, which consists of a timing belt and two pulleys.
The conveyor is available either with or without the supporting structure The structure of the conveyor is made of aluminium grooved profiles of the “item” modular system. The supporting structure can also be designed and manufactured with an adjustable height (manual or with a drive) or in a diagonal arrangement.
The conveyor is also available including electrical connection
Advantages of timing belt conveyors:
Possibility of moving wide lump materials
Possibility of selecting more than two branches
Thanks to the gap between the individual branches, it is possible to convey even the materials that reach under the upper branch of the conveyor
Higher load-carrying capacity than belt conveyors
Fast assembly and delivery
Quiet run, allowing the use of conveyors in assembly lines with permanent attendance (of an operator)
Possibility of managing special customer requirements, such as a conveyor for an environment with an increased occurrence of oil
